Change is inevitable in every condominium community — whether it’s updating amenities, improving building systems, or enhancing common areas. But not all changes are created equal, and understanding when owner involvement or approval is required is essential for every Board and Manager.
Join us for this one-hour session as our expert panel breaks down Section 97 of the Condominium Act, explaining the difference between repairs, maintenance, and changes, and when a change becomes a substantial change requiring owner notice or approval. Through practical examples and real-world scenarios, we’ll clarify the process, help you avoid common pitfalls, and ensure your condominium remains compliant while moving forward with improvements.
Key Takeaways:
- Understand what qualifies as a change under Section 97
- Distinguish between ordinary maintenance, repair, and substantial change
- Learn the proper notice and approval requirements
- Hear best practices to minimize disputes and delays
Whether you’re a Condominium Manager, Board Director, or Owner, this session will help you navigate change with confidence and compliance.
